So, what exactly is AMD FSR 4? To simplify, think of it as a magic lens through which your games can be played at higher resolutions without the hardware needing to break a sweat. Just like how a professional photographer adjusts the settings on their camera to get that clear, crisp shot, FSR 4 enhances graphical fidelity effectively. It allows older, less powerful graphics processing units (GPUs) to work smarter, not harder, enabling gamers to experience visuals that are closer to what newer GPUs provide.

One of the standout benefits of FSR 4 is the remarkable improvement in image quality. Previous iterations of upscaling technologies might have presented gamers with clear visuals but often came at the cost of distortions, leading to the aforementioned artifacts, which, in layman’s terms, are just visual glitches that can occur, like seeing a pixelated sandwich instead of a vibrant burger. However, FSR 4 significantly reduces these blemishes, making gaming a smoother and more enjoyable experience. That said, all good things often come with a few caveats. Unfortunately, FSR 4 will only be compatible with newer GPUs. Think of it this way: upgrading your GPU today is like signing up for a premium streaming service; you want to experience the latest shows with all the frills. If you’re clinging to old hardware, you might be missing out on the latest and greatest features. While the compatibility requirement might sound a bit exclusive, it’s important to understand that modern GPUs are built with specific architectures that support advanced features like FSR 4. They can harness the power of new technologies to deliver an unmatched gaming experience.
